Why The Daily Telegraph Articles Stick Around on Google
The Daily Telegraph is a high-authority news site. That means Google treats it like gospel. Once a story about you is published—even if it’s unfair, outdated, or totally misleading—it’s likely to stick to the top of search results for months or even years.
These articles can include:
- Old legal matters you’ve moved past
- Misleading headlines with clickbait appeal
- One-sided coverage of personal disputes
- Accusations that never led to charges or convictions
For many Australians, these articles have nothing to do with who they are today—but the internet doesn’t care. Your digital footprint needs intervention.
